Convert Joule to Giga-electronvolt

Unit definitions

Joule

The joule is the SI unit of energy. It is defined as the work done when a force of one newton is applied over a distance of one meter.

Giga-electronvolt

$10^{9} \ \text{eV}$ is a giga-electronvolt.

How to convert Joule to Giga-electronvolt

$$\text{Energy}_{\text{GeV}} = \text{Energy}_{\text{J}} \cdot 6241509744.511525597484404935665570$$
